> Does anyone know if it's possible to install Bind 9.0 or 9.1 on the RaQ?
My
Yes, it is possible.
> ISP has told me I should do this, and that it would be safer than 8.2.3.
Do
> you know it Bind 9 or 9.1 will even work with the cobalt GUI?
It will not work with the Cobalt GUI (unless you modify some of the Cobalt
Perl Scripts).
We have been running BIND 9.x for 3 months now (approximately). We use our
own in-house developed DNS administration system (works on real SQL
databases and serves DNS data directly from the database without having to
generate the text config files).
